Another Pick 6 Carryover and other Del Mar News

Despite being open for only a few days this season, today’s card at Del Mar features yet another pick 6 carryover. The extra payout this time is $103,938. On Thursday, July 29, Holding Her Ground had an upset victory in the seventh race. The horse ended up paying $54. Since no one with a would-be winning ticket had chosen her, the carryover was extended to today’s card.

The Pick 6 begins with the third race on Friday’s card. The Cougar II Handicap is included in this card and will take place as the seventh race of the day. Richard’s Kid, the 8/5 morning line favorite, will be skipping tomorrow’s San Diego Handicap so that he can race today.

Del Mar has been the subject of scrutiny yet again, as a rider was injured during a training run. Jeff Bloom, an exercise rider and former jockey, was injured in a single horse spill that resulted in a trip to the local hospital. He was conscious and speaking when he was taken away.

The question regarding the safety of the new track surface remains. Was this a fluke accident, or was it caused by the same problem that track officials attempted to fix last week?
